Apr 17, 2006 · They are 1) Market order (which executes instantly at whatever price the stock is trading at that moment), 2) Limit Order (an order where you enter the exact price you wish to sell at which may or may not be filled depending on price action), and MOC orders (which sell your shares market-on-close at the final moments of trading at the end-of-day).
